Harvest Defense by BrazMogu 2018-12-26T23:03:27Z

@huvaakoodia I very much appreciate the in-depth commentary. Here are a few responses...

The game was poorly balanced and polished, yes. The idea took me a night of sleep to finally come, and I missed most of monday due to work, so I did it all in around 48 hours. I left polish and even basic interface (like a main menu) for later. This is not a defense, just maybe a statement of self-awareness, I suppose :P

My thought of "sacrifice" is that selling a grown tower means resources, but also means having to rely on weaker towers for a while, which can be devastating. Of course, as you've shown there are strategies that minimize the impact of the sacrifice. My personal one while play-testing was to sell two shrooms and replace them with 3 new ones until the base was surrounded and then start to work on the Shriekers.

Glad you had fun, and also glad to see a screenshot of a game I made posted by someone else. That's really satisfying. :)
